Advanced Cancer Stage and Healthcare Coverage Predict Longitudinal Psychological Distress and Clinical Outcomes in Patients Undergoing Radiotherapy
The goal of this observational study is to understand the emotional and physical burden (distress) experienced by cancer patients as they go through radiotherapy treatmen. Researchers want to learn what specific problems such as physical symptoms, financial worries, or travel issues most affect a patient's well-being and how those feelings change over the course of several weeks of care.
The main questions it aims to answer are:
Does high distress lead to negative clinical results, such as missing radiation appointments, significant weight changes, or needing to be admitted to the hospital unexpectedly? Which groups of patients are at the highest risk for severe distress (for example, those with advanced-stage cancer or those using specific types of health insurance)? What are the most common physical, practical, and emotional problems that cause distress during the different phases of treatment?
Participants will:
Complete a survey about their health history and background before treatment begins.
Rate their distress level on a scale of 0 to 10 (using a tool called a Distress Thermometer) and check off specific concerns from a 42-item list each week during their 2 to 8 weeks of radiotherapy.
Complete one final follow-up assessment one month after finishing their radiotherapy treatment.
Study Rationale and Objective: Psychological distress in cancer patients is a recognized catalyst for negative clinical outcomes, yet it remains under-monitored in many tertiary care settings. This research was designed as a prospective longitudinal study to move beyond single-point prevalence surveys and capture the fluctuating nature of distress throughout the radiotherapy (RT) trajectory. The primary objective was to evaluate the longitudinal patterns of distress and identify independent clinical and socioeconomic predictors that correlate with treatment adherence and unplanned healthcare utilization.
Operational Framework: The study tracked a purposive sample of 374 cancer outpatients across eight distinct assessment phases: Baseline (T0): Pre-treatment assessment of demographic, socioeconomic, and clinical status.
Weekly Monitoring (T1-T8): Real-time tracking of distress levels and symptom accumulation throughout the typical 2- to 8-week RT course.
Follow-up (T9): Post-treatment assessment one month after the completion of radiotherapy.
Multidimensional Assessment: Distress was quantified using the NCCN Distress Thermometer (DT), a 0-10 visual analogue scale, with a score≥4 triggering clinical concern. To identify the specific drivers of this distress, participants utilized a 42-item Problem List covering five critical domains:
Physical: Monitoring the accumulation of RT-related side effects such as fatigue, pain, and changes in appearance.
Practical: Identifying logistical barriers, including financial instability (specifically under the Universal Coverage Scheme), transportation difficulties, and work interference.
Psychological: Tracking anxiety, fear, and sadness. Social/Family: Assessing caregiving burdens and relationship stressors. Spiritual: Exploring concerns regarding faith and the meaning of life. Statistical Focus: The study employed multivariate ordinal logistic regression to isolate independent predictors of distress severity while controlling for age and gender. This rigorous analysis aimed to confirm how clinical factors, such as Advanced Cancer Stage (III-IV), and socioeconomic factors, such as Healthcare Coverage type, significantly increase the risk of high psychological burden. By correlating these predictors with tangible clinical outcomes, including significant weight changes, missed appointments, and unplanned hospital admissions, the study provides an evidence-based rationale for a multidisciplinary, holistic nursing approach in oncology departments.
